🔹 Local News: Malaysia Raises Paddy Floor Price

The Malaysian government has increased the paddy floor price to RM1,500 per metric tonne, effective February 16. This move aims to support farmers facing rising costs of wages and agricultural inputs.

🔹 International News: Monkey Escape in South Carolina

Authorities in South Carolina are on high alert after a group of monkeys escaped from a transport truck, triggering a public safety warning and an ongoing search operation.

🔹 Regional News: Australia-China Military Tensions

Tensions escalate as Australia accuses China of unsafe military actions over the South China Sea. Reports confirm that a Chinese jet released flares dangerously close to an Australian surveillance aircraft, increasing diplomatic concerns.

🔹 ALPS News: Breakthrough in Stem Cell Research

ALPS has partnered with UKM and Xiamen University on a pioneering stem cell therapy project for Alzheimer’s Disease. This research integrates electroacupuncture and stem cell treatment, aiming to revolutionize neurodegenerative disease treatments. The official signing ceremony took place on October 29, 2024, marking a significant milestone in ALPS’ biotechnology advancements.
